The ingredients needed to make To Improve Your Blood Circulation: Sweet Onion Rice:
  1. Take 160 grams Sweet new harvest onion
  2. Get 360 ml Uncooked white rice
  3. Make ready 3 tbsp Sakura shrimp
  4. Make ready 1 Aburaage
  5. Prepare 1 tbsp ★Cooking sake
  6. Make ready 1 tsp ★Sesame oil
  7. Get 1 tbsp ★Mirin
  8. Prepare 1/2 tsp each ★Salt, soy sauce
Instructions to make To Improve Your Blood Circulation: Sweet Onion Rice:
  1. Rinse the rice and soak in water for about 30 minutes.
  2. Slice the onion to 5 mm width. Pour hot water over the aburaage to drain excess oil, and cut into 5 mm wide strips.
  3. Put the rice from Step 1 in a rice cooker. Add water up to the 2 cup mark, add the ingredients from Step 2, and the ★ ingredients. Stir well and set the rice cooker to cook.
